The acquisition will proceed under solicitation number N00173-16-R-JF01 Presolicitation Synopsis (amended) for: Radio-Frequency (RF) Continuous-Wave (CW) Microwave-Power-Module (MPM) Amplifiers Solicitation Number: N00173-14-R-DE01 (original synopsis) Solicitation Number: N00173-14-R-DE01C (corrected synopsis) The Surface Electronic Warfare Systems Branch at the US Naval Research Laboratory, Washington, DC, is responsible for research, design, and development of onboard Electronic Warfare (EW) technologies, techniques, and systems to deny or degrade hostile use of the electromagnetic spectrum and protect naval ships. This includes threat assessment and definition, development of EW operational concepts, EW requirements definition, electronic countermeasure technique research and analysis, EW signal processing research, EW system research and prototype system development, EW technique and system effectiveness evaluation, field experimentation, and system effectiveness assessments. The Naval Research Laboratory (NRL) Tactical Electronic Warfare Division (TEWD) has a need for Radio-Frequency (RF) Continuous-Wave (CW) Microwave-Power-Module (MPM) Amplifiers for use as transmitters in a developmental system. The RF CW MPM amplifiers will be used to design and evaluate prototype shipboard and airborne EW applications and will be mounted in an enclosure that will be installed on both surface shipboard and airborne platforms. The required items shall be procured in accordance with technical specifications in the Statement of Work (SOW), which will be available with the solicitation. The contractor shall deliver the units as listed in the SOW, and meet all performance criteria provided in the technical specifications and detailed requirements of the SOW. The contractor shall adhere to specifications and requirements including, but not limited to; - Frequency - Power Output - Time Delay - Duty Cycle - Pulse Characteristics - Linear Gain - Input/Output Based on a survey of the market, the Government has determined that the supplies to be acquired meet the definition of a commercial item. Therefore, the Government intends to use FAR Part 12, Acquisition of Commercial Items. A firm-fixed-price, indefinite-delivery, indefinite-quantity contract with a three-year ordering period is contemplated.
